Size and Specifications of a 20ft Shipping Container
Before exploring the myriad uses of 20ft shipping containers, it's vital to comprehend their dimensions and specs. Below is a table summarizing the basic dimensions:
SpecificationDimensionsExternal Length20 feet (6.058 m)External Width8 ft (2.438 m)External Height8.5 ft (2.591 m)Internal Length19.4 feet (5.898 m)Internal Width7.7 ft (2.352 m)Internal Height7.9 feet (2.385 m)Door Opening Width7.5 ft (2.28 m)Door Opening Height7.5 ft (2.28 m)WeightRoughly 4,800 pounds (2,160 kg)Maximum PayloadAround 48,000 pounds (21,772 kg)Key Features of 20ft Shipping ContainersDurability: Made from top quality steel, these containers are resistant to corrosion, rust, and extreme climate condition.Portability: They can be quickly transferred utilizing trucks, ships, or cranes.Security: The robust locking mechanisms provide a high level of security for stored goods.Customizability: They can be modified for different uses, consisting of windows, doors, insulation, and electrical fittings.Applications of 20ft Shipping Containers
The adaptability of 20ft shipping containers allows them to serve multiple purposes across various industries. Below are some common applications:
1. Storage Solutions
Lots of services and individuals use 20ft containers as on-site storage units for equipment, stock, or individual valuables. Their security functions and weather resistance make them perfect for long-term storage.
2. Modular Homes and Offices
Container homes are a popular trend in sustainable living. A 20ft shipping container can be transformed into a cozy living space or a functional office. They can be stacked or organized in different setups, allowing for creative design possibilities.
3. Pop-up Retail Spaces
Business owners are progressively using shipping containers for pop-up stores and food stalls. Their mobility enables organizations to start a business in numerous locations, making them an attractive alternative for startups.
4. Mobile Workshops
Artisans and professionals can repurpose 20ft shipping containers into mobile workshops, geared up with tools and area for numerous projects. This setup supplies versatility and convenience for tradespeople.
5. Emergency situation Housing
In disaster relief circumstances, 20ft shipping containers can be converted into short-term housing units. They offer a fast and effective solution to provide shelter in emergency situation circumstances.
6. Storage for Construction Sites
Construction business typically utilize containers to store devices, tools, and materials safely. With a 20ft shipping container, they can keep their tools arranged and protected from theft or weather condition damage.

A1: The price of a 20ft shipping container differs based on its condition (new vs. Used Cargo Containers), place, and modifications. Normally, prices vary from ₤ 2,000 to ₤ 4,500.
Q2: Can a 20ft shipping container be used for living?
A2: Yes, many individuals convert 20ft Shipping Container Housing containers (https://pad.karuka.tech/s/P_hadngf8) into homes or living areas. Modifications can consist of insulation, windows, pipes, and electrical circuitry.
Q3: Do shipping containers require authorizations for use?
A3: This depends on regional guidelines. It's vital to contact local authorities concerning zoning laws and permits before using a shipping container for domestic or business functions.
Q4: How can a 20ft shipping container be transferred?
A4: Shipping containers can be transported using truck trailers, cranes, or shipping vessels. They are designed for simple loading and dumping.
Q5: Are shipping containers insulated?
A5: Standard shipping containers are not insulated. However, insulation can be added throughout the modification procedure to make them suitable for living or climate-sensitive storage.
